Q. How does Broadcast A Resume VideoPro work?
A. VideoPro is a Windows based application that can be launched from the Desktop, shortcut toolbar and Programs Menu. When VideoPro video email is opened, the user will notice two (2) tabs, “Create a New Video” and “View Video Archive.” From the Create a New Video tab, the user can title, record, playback, re-record their videos and when satisfied with the video can click the Save and Upload button to upload the video to the PatriotNet server. You will then copy the hyperlink to the streaming video into the Windows Clipboard, ready to be added to any electronic document. You are then free to send out the email or electronic document to any recipient. An archive of videos that have been created can be accessed in the “View Video Archive” tab, which allows the user to review, resend or delete old videos. The user has the option to save a local copy of the video during upload or to delete the local copy after the upload process has been completed. When the recipient receives the email or opens the electronic document, they will be able to simply click on the hyperlink and this will automatically open a web page to view the streaming video message.

Q. What is the recommended bandwidth for using VideoPro?
A. VideoPro is designed for full-motion video and audio streaming for a broadband connection. This means your recipient should have a DSL or Cable Modem Internet connection, with a throughput of 256kbps download speed; however, there are not any software limitations with using a dial-up connection. If using a dial-up connection to send, the client will notice a longer file upload period. If the recipient uses dial-up to receive video emails they will notice a reduction in the quality of the steaming video
